Chelsea Wing-Back Moses Gives Assurance That He Will Fly To Abuja
Published: November 07, 2016
Allnigeriasoccer.com understands that Chelsea right wing-back Victor Moses has promised that he will not reject his call-up for the World Cup qualifying match with Algeria on Saturday, November 12.
Super Eagles manager Rohr has given Moses the benefit of the doubt and recalled him to the national team for the game with the North Africans, amid speculations in the local media that he faked an injury which ruled him out of the opener against Zambia.
Moses’s camp has confirmed that he will be in Abuja and that statement has been echoed by Nigeria Football Federation officials.
The former England U17 star has not played for the Super Eagles since September 3 when he lasted 84 minutes on the pitch in an African Nations Cup qualifier versus Tanzania.
